Understanding the Shipping Container 20GP China to UK Cost in 2026
Market conditions in early 2026 have stabilized significantly following the logistical disruptions seen in previous years. Consequently, businesses can now plan their budgets with greater accuracy when importing goods from major Chinese manufacturing hubs.
The standard 20ft General Purpose (20GP) container remains the workhorse of global trade due to its versatility and cost-effectiveness. Furthermore, it provides an ideal volume for small to medium-sized shipments that do not require the massive capacity of a 40HQ unit.
Importers should expect the base ocean freight for a 20GP container to range between 2,000 and 2,800 USD. However, these figures represent port-to-port costs and do not include local handling or delivery fees.
Choosing sea freight allows companies to move heavy or bulky items without the prohibitive costs associated with air transport. Therefore, most retail and industrial businesses prioritize this method for their primary supply chain needs.
Key Factors Influencing Your 20GP Container Freight Rates
Several dynamic variables determine the final price you pay for your shipment from China to the United Kingdom. Specifically, fuel surcharges and seasonal demand fluctuations play a massive role in weekly price adjustments.
Peak seasons typically occur between August and October as retailers prepare for the winter holiday rush. During these months, rates can increase by 15-25% due to limited vessel space and equipment shortages.
Port congestion at major UK gateways like Felixstowe or Southampton can also lead to additional surcharges. Moreover, local haulage costs within the UK fluctuate based on driver availability and fuel prices.
Utilizing professional customs brokerage services ensures you avoid unnecessary delays and fines. Indeed, proper documentation is just as vital as the physical transport of your cargo.
How Does Sea Freight Compare to Other Shipping Options?
While ocean transport is the most common method, it is not the only way to move goods across the Eurasian continent. Businesses must weigh the trade-offs between speed and expense when selecting their logistics strategy.
Rail freight has emerged as a powerful middle-ground solution for those needing faster delivery than sea but lower costs than air. For instance, shipping via the Silk Road rail network can cut transit times by nearly half.
Air freight remains the premium choice for high-value or time-sensitive electronics and pharmaceuticals. Nevertheless, the cost for a full container equivalent by air is often ten times higher than sea freight.
| Shipping Method | Cost Range (20GP) | Transit Time | Best For |
|---|---|---|---|
| Sea Freight | $2,000 – $2,800 | 30-38 Days | Bulk & General Cargo |
| Rail Freight | $3,500 – $4,800 | 18-22 Days | Mid-Value Goods |
| Air Freight | $12,000 – $18,000 | 5-7 Days | Urgent/High-Value |
| Sea-Air Hybrid | $5,000 – $7,500 | 14-18 Days | Balanced Priority |

Transit Times and Port Selection for China to UK Routes
The duration of your shipment depends heavily on which Chinese port you select for departure. Southern ports like Shenzhen and Guangzhou often offer shorter routes to the Suez Canal compared to northern ports like Tianjin.
Direct services from Shanghai to Felixstowe typically take around 32 to 35 days under normal weather conditions. In contrast, transshipment routes via Singapore or Colombo might add another 5 to 10 days to the total timeline.
Choosing rail freight can reduce this window to approximately 20 days if your supplier is located in inland cities like Chengdu or Xi’an. Consequently, inland manufacturers often prefer rail to avoid the long haul to the coast.
Importers should also account for ‘door-to-port’ and ‘port-to-door’ legs of the journey. These segments can add several days depending on the efficiency of local trucking networks.
Breaking Down Additional Surcharges and Customs Fees
The base freight rate is only one component of the total shipping container 20gp china to uk cost. You must also factor in Terminal Handling Charges (THC) at both the origin and destination ports.
Documentation fees, Bill of Lading charges, and security surcharges usually add a few hundred dollars to the invoice. Additionally, UK VAT and import duties are calculated based on the Value for Taxes (VFT), which includes the cost of goods plus shipping and insurance.
Standard UK VAT is currently 20%, though certain items may qualify for different rates. Therefore, accurately classifying your goods with the correct HS Code is essential for financial planning.

FCL vs LCL: Is a 20GP Container the Right Choice?
Full Container Load (FCL) shipping means you have exclusive use of the 20GP unit. This method is generally safer and faster because the container remains sealed from the supplier to your warehouse.
Less than Container Load (LCL) is more economical if your cargo volume is less than 15 cubic meters. However, LCL involves consolidation and deconsolidation, which increases the risk of damage and adds transit time.
Most businesses find that once they reach 14-16 CBM, the cost of a 20GP FCL becomes cheaper than paying for LCL per cubic meter. Furthermore, FCL simplifies the door to door delivery process significantly.
Market data suggests that 20GP containers are the most popular choice for UK SMEs due to their manageable size and lower upfront investment compared to 40ft units.
Real-World Case Studies: Shipping from China to the UK
Examining real scenarios helps clarify the total landed cost for different types of cargo. These examples reflect typical market rates as of early 2026.
Case Study 1: Electronics Distribution Route: Shenzhen, China to Felixstowe, UK Cargo: Consumer electronics, 28 CBM, 12,000 kg Container: 20GP Shipping Details: – Carrier: Major carrier (Direct) – Port of Loading: Shenzhen – Port of Discharge: Felixstowe Cost Breakdown: – Ocean Freight: $2,450 – Origin Charges: $420 – Destination Charges: $580 – Customs and Duties: $1,150 – Total Landed Cost: $4,600 Timeline: 39 days door-to-door. Key Insight: Direct routing minimized handling risks for fragile electronics.
Case Study 2: Home Furniture Import Route: Ningbo, China to Southampton, UK Cargo: Wooden furniture, 30 CBM, 8,500 kg Container: 20GP Shipping Details: – Carrier: Major carrier (Transshipment via Singapore) – Port of Loading: Ningbo – Port of Discharge: Southampton Cost Breakdown: – Ocean Freight: $2,250 – Origin Charges: $380 – Destination Charges: $520 – Customs and Duties: $850 – Total Landed Cost: $4,000 Timeline: 45 days door-to-door. Key Insight: Choosing a transshipment route saved $200 but added 6 days to the schedule.

Strategies to Reduce Your Shipping Container 20GP China to UK Cost
Reducing logistics expenses requires a proactive approach to planning and negotiation. For instance, booking your shipment at least 3-4 weeks in advance can secure lower rates before vessel space becomes tight.
Optimizing your packaging to fit more items into a single 20GP container can lower the cost per unit of inventory. Additionally, consider shipping during ‘slack’ periods like March or April when demand is at its lowest.
Consolidating shipments from multiple suppliers into one FCL container is another effective strategy. This approach reduces the number of individual customs entries and local delivery charges you must pay.
